System Administrator
Leidos is seeking an experienced System Administrator to support autonomous maritime projects’ hardware stacks by managing and maintaining Linux-based systems in an on-premises system integration lab. The role focuses on system configuration, monitoring, troubleshooting, and ensuring the security and integrity of Linux servers and workstations, while collaborating with cross-functional teams for system deployments and operational readiness.

Responsibilities
Ensure the reliability, security, and efficiency of our servers, networks, and system integration laboratories
Perform system monitoring, performance tuning, and troubleshooting to ensure high availability and reliability
Manage system patches, upgrades, and security hardening in compliance with DoD policies
Provide support for system backups, disaster recovery, and data integrity
Configure and maintain network services including routing, firewalls, DNS, and VLANS
Assist in managing system access, user accounts, and security configurations
Collaborate with teams to support software deployments and integration
Create and maintain documentation pertaining to system operating procedures
Participate in incident response and resolve issues related to system performance, security, and availability
